Message type: E = Error
Message class: OIJ_TDP - IS-OIL Downstream TSW: TDP related messages
Message number: 002
Message text: Plant for Stock transfer movement missing: &1

- Plant for Stock transfer movement missing: &1 ?The SAP error message OIJ_TDP002, which states "Plant for Stock transfer movement missing: &1," typically occurs in the context of stock transfer processes within the SAP system, particularly in the Oil and Gas industry (as indicated by the OIJ prefix). This error indicates that the system is unable to identify a plant associated with a stock transfer movement, which is necessary for processing the transaction.
Cause:
- Missing Plant Assignment: The most common cause of this error is that the stock transfer movement does not have a plant assigned to it. This could happen if the plant was not specified during the transaction entry or if there is a configuration issue.
- Incorrect Configuration: The plant may not be properly configured in the system, or the relevant settings for stock transfer movements may be incomplete.
- Data Entry Error: There may be a typographical error or incorrect data entry when specifying the plant in the stock transfer document.
- Master Data Issues: The material master or other related master data may not have the necessary plant information.
Solution:
- Check Transaction Entry: Review the stock transfer transaction to ensure that the plant is correctly specified. If it is missing, enter the correct plant code.
- Verify Plant Configuration: Ensure that the plant is properly configured in the system. This includes checking the plant settings in the configuration (SPRO) and ensuring that it is active and valid for stock transfer movements.
- Review Master Data: Check the material master data to ensure that the plant is assigned to the material being transferred. You can do this by using transaction MM03 to view the material master.
- Consult Documentation: If you are unsure about the correct plant or configuration, consult the relevant SAP documentation or your organization's SAP support team for guidance.
- Error Logs: Check the system logs for any additional error messages or warnings that may provide more context about the issue.
